Transaction 8fd18ef3a23a932da2897b37ce5721113df08d9989e5659a67c4d24f2b4f156f
1 Input
1 Output
-
8fd18ef3a23a932da2897b37ce5721113df08d9989e5659a67c4d24f2b4f156f:0
- value
- 180893
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2520f9a2b9c58d19db007145da52b6b25b759c8
- address
- bc1quffqlx3tn3vdr8dsqu29mfftdvjmwkwgrgsulr